Smith & Wesson M&P15 .300 Whisper

Smith & Wesson took one of its most well known designs and paired it with an increasingly popular caliber to create the M&P15 300 Whisper. Though chambered in .300 Whisper, it will also safely fire .300 AAC Blackout.

Dimension Africa

Thompson/Center's switch-barrel Dimension is affordable and versatile, but it needed to pass a rigorous field test to prove itself: Africa. NRA's John Zent had a chance to handle the Dimension while in Africa's Stormberg Mountains and brought back some photographic evidence of its success.

Building a Red Dot Race Gun

The Glock pistol has become one of the most common pistols on the planet, and has reached a level of ubiquity in handguns previously achieved only by 1911s. It’s now possible to build a competition ready race gun for USPSA Open Division on a “Glock” platform from the ground up, using no Glock parts.

Alpen Optics Honors Injured Female Veterans

Alpen Optics, along with Mississippi Outdoors, Mississippi Department of Wildlife, Prois, Fisheries and Parks and PVA-ORHF recently hosted a turkey hunt/fishing event for injured female veterans to "celebrate" these women and the sacrifices they've made for our country.
